report-imgEast Asia Update - April 2007
Ten Years After the Asian Crisis
East Asian economies are growing strong, but as they climb steadily to higher income levels, the next challenge is to avoid the "middle-income trap", says World Bank's semi-annual analysis of the region . More

East Asian Finance: the Road to Robust Markets (Final Edition)
The report notes that to make the most of the $1.6 trillion in foreign reserves and $9.6 trillion in domestic financial sector assets, East Asia needs to further diversify its financial markets by developing its securities markets .   More

Trading on Time
Delays have a great impact on a developing country's exports, especially perishable agricultural products, says latest IFC/WB study. It highlights the need to improve trade facilitation.

Not If, But When
Adapting to Natural Hazards in the Pacific Islands Region. Report calls for urgent action to reduce the risks facing Pacific Islands countries from more intense and more frequent cyclones   More
